AIPGMEE 2014: Results to be out by 31 Jan


The National Board of Examinations (NBE) and Prometric India have announced the successful completion of the All India Post Graduate Medical Entrance Examination (AIPGMEE) for admission to MD/MS courses in 2014.

72,197 candidates had registered for the test from 71 centers in 38 cities. 

AIPGMEE 2014 was conducted from 25 November to 6 December, 2013 without any technical issues and the results are expected to be announced on schedule i.e. by 31 January, 2014, said Bipin Batra, Executive Director, National Board of Examinations.

AIPGMEE 2014 was a computer based test (CBT) conducted by the NBE in collaboration with the testing agency, Pro metric.

This year, the state governments of Haryana, Punjab, Chhattisgarh, Himachal Pradesh, Odisha, Madhya Pradesh, Kerala and the University of Delhi will utilize the AIPGMEE 2014 results for admission to MD/MS/PG diploma courses at colleges which fall under their control. These states will not conduct any separate state entrance examination of their own.

Admission to MD/MS/PG diploma course for institutes under Armed Forces Medical Services will also be made on the basis of results of the AIPGMEE 2014.

The MD/MS course is three years long from the date of admission and candidates are eligible foradmission once they complete the compulsory rotating internship.

The Diploma course is two years long from the date of admission after completion of compulsory rotating internship.
